Output ec56e92828647436f3b42e959f5da7db5ef9952217d05967b42f1d986e379cbd:2

value
26586906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6bfc3fe7e2661b895a4513159d32fd621485f68 OP_EQUAL
address
MUwFNfATE95xr39BpTTkGuMs5BcoNnFuqa
transaction
ec56e92828647436f3b42e959f5da7db5ef9952217d05967b42f1d986e379cbd
spent
true